FilipeParticipantIn my opinion the only issue I suffer from those high-level enemies is the perk battering ram because it changes the way you fight against them, exemple: in the early game you can abuse the block move even if there are too many enemies you could dispatch one by one just with the right timing betweing blocking and thrusting but after they get the hands on that dirty perk thats decided soleny on chance ( as dirty as the crit based on max health by the way ) (and for players I dont think its usefull anyway) can bypass your defences like its nothing and even worse it seems like they “know” when it’s triggered, what I mean with that is that they only thrust you when its sure they will bypass you defences so its even harder to get an opening from their part to get a counter attack because when you do so you’re open to getting hit by the others, so u cant choose when to hit and when to block.
